Transaction 15e24fb604071ff4dec960e72bc3206970e378c1dd5c83bc0dfbdc7bd85cdeef

1 Input
2 Outputs
  • 15e24fb604071ff4dec960e72bc3206970e378c1dd5c83bc0dfbdc7bd85cdeef:0
  • value  592502
    address  32k9gEP816XkHbvE4tUpPLHksPwmHQ49cC
  • 15e24fb604071ff4dec960e72bc3206970e378c1dd5c83bc0dfbdc7bd85cdeef:1
  • value  21775754
    address  1Dxwnro8WCjb8wYiPnp3tSCJZCdCpLCJge